Houska Castle was founded approximately in the same period (1270 through 1280) as the nearby royal castle Bezděz . The founder of the castle was Czech King Premysl Otakar II. Houska Castle was built on the site of an original stronghold and over the years it was gradually remodelled. At present, you can see a mixture of building styles from the Gothic to the Renaissance. There were various owners during the centuries, e.g. the lords of Dubá, Jan of Smiřice, the Wallensteins, , Princess Hohenlohe or Countess Andrassy. The last owners, Jaromir Šimonek and Blanka Horová, are the descendants of the president of Skoda car factories and a Senator of the Czechoslovak Republic Joseph Šimonek, who bought the castle in 1924. Houska Castle was opened to public in 1999. The castle is known for a number of cultural events , e.g. fairs, musical performances, corporate events with historical elements, or weddings.
